Here's what Amari Cooper said about Sims during a pre-practice interview:

"He's been practicing, so we'll be all right. He's getting better every day."

Also, a reminder of what Nick Saban said Monday:

"Blake was able to throw the ball at the end of the week last week. We had him on kind of a pitch count. He feels a lot better now, so we feel like's OK and will be ready to practice and be ready to go."

-- WR DeAndrew White appeared to have an increased workload from the previous day. It's unclear what sort of injury he's dealing with, though he was wearing a medical boot last week when he pedaled on a stationary bike. ...

-- In the words of Cooper, here's why White's an important part of Alabama's passing game:

"It's a tough matchup for defenses with DeAndrew out there because he's a great player and he's a great route runner." ...

And Yeldon is still slowed by a hamstring ...
